What you'll do on a typical day:


  • Build industry-changing applications for the third-party logistics industry

  • Develop user stories, annotated wireframes, mockups, and prototypes

  • Drive user centered design as a Lead UX Designer in conjunction with the Senior UX Manager

  • Eager to learn about new technologies and products

  • Be the users voice and drive design interaction of key customer facing products

  • Work closely with Stakeholders, Product Analysts, Managers, QA, and Software Engineers

  • Build efficient and reusable design components/patterns

  • Interact with other team members to incorporate innovations and vice versa

  • Identify and foster best practices for user experience design in web, desktop, and mobile interfaces

  • Understand, participate and in some cases, facilitate in the requirements gathering process

  • Reports directly to the Senior UX Manager


What you need to succeed at XPO:

At a minimum, you'll need:


  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ent related work or military experience

  • 2 years of UX design experience


It'd be great if you also have:

  • 3+ years of design experience in a web application environment

  • Highly proficient with Sketch, Invision and Invision Inspect

  • Direct experience with Agile/Scrum software development practices

  • Aptitude for software development beyond the look and feel

  • Experience with web and mobile User Interfaces

  • Has a portfolio of ux-based designs

  • Care deeply about enterprise level usability and high-quality software applications

  • Have an artistic flare and is passionate about simplifying human-to-computer interactions

  • Smart, driven problem solver who characterizes themselves as a 'lifelong' learner

  • Can communicate with peers and business users
